Chichén Itzá: The Main Attraction
The first stop is the legendary Chichén Itzá, where your certified guide will narrate the history behind this UNESCO World Heritage site. You’ll spend about two hours here, enough time to soak in the grandeur of the El Castillo pyramid, the Temple of the Warriors, the Ball Court, and other iconic structures. Cenote Chihuan: A Refreshing Break
Next, you’ll venture to Cenote Chihuan, a cave cenote that’s off the usual tourist path. Here, you can swim in crystal-clear waters and marvel at the stunning rock formations. The admission is included, and you’ll have about two hours to relax and cool off.
Guests have found this cenote to be a “unique” experience, far from the busier tourist spots, offering a more authentic connection with nature. The swim gear, including life jackets and goggles, is provided for your comfort and safety.
Izamal & ATV Adventure
The highlight for many travelers is the ATV Drive Experience in Izamal, known as the “Yellow City” for its bright colonial buildings. Guided by a local expert, you’ll zip around the jungle, archaeological sites, and the colorful streets of this charming town.
The adrenaline rush is a hit—reviewers describe it as “the most excited part,” and the guides ensure safety with equipment like security gear and face towels. It’s a fun, active way to see the town beyond foot traffic, and you’ll love the views of the town’s vibrant architecture and lush surroundings.
Following the ATV ride, you’ll explore Izamal’s historic streets and visit the archaeological site, giving you a taste of how the town blends history and local color.
